What or Who is a PHADDER?
Literally, the word Phadder (plural “Phaddrar”) means “god-father”/”god-parent” spelled with a “Ph” to sound cool (Sw. “fadder”/”faddrar”). It can be loosely interpreted as a College Parent. A Phadder is a friend/god-father/god-mother to new students at Chalmers.
A phadder is basically either a current student at Chalmers or an alumni. He/she has finished or completed 6 months – 1 year of studies at Chalmers and has volunteered to help new students. Typically a Phadder is a kind and social person interested in giving a helping hand to new students and making friends with people from various different countries and cultures.
